yes. The 40 size plan is the only one that I'm aware of. As you can see it has the original markings in the specs section in the bottom right of the plan.
Scalings:
Tsunami 20 (48/58.5 = 82.05%)
Length = 40.75" (Should be 41" but spinner has nose cutoff)
Wing Span = 48.0"
Wing Area = 377 sq in
Stab Span = 20.4"
Spinner & Wheels = 2.00"
Tsunami 10 (43.25/58.5 = 73.93%)
Length = 36.75"
Wing Span = 43.25"
Wing Area = 307 sq in
Stab Span = 18.4"
Spinner & Wheels = 1.75"
The percent scale numbers are the figures you should use to scale the ribs. I plan to omit ribs W6, W8 and W10 from the T10 for a wing with 8 ribs per panel. For the T20 I'd probably go with 9 ribs but spaced differently which would require relofting the ribs or simply band sawing blanks in between root and tip templates and spacing them out evenly.
Also, since the nose rings don't scale to even 1.75" or 2.00" diameters, modify the size of the nose to match that size and obtain the scaling factor increase to augment the width of the formers forward of the wing LE. The additional equivalent height can be added to the bottom of the formers for a slightly less pronounced curve to the top sheet fairing into the spinner but keeping the curvature of the bottom sheeting. The tail of the plane is simply brought together aft of the wing LE former and structured internally as required.
